Symptoms of low hemoglobin level in your wife include shortness of breath, fatigue, muscle aches, and others. The recommended iron and vitamin tablet is commonly used to boost hemoglobin levels. She needs to follow the recommended course and nutritional advice. If symptoms persist or worsen, the patient should seek advice from a physician for further assessment. On other occasions, further evaluation and specialized care may require additional test or a consultation with a hematologist. It is important to monitor hemoglobin levels regularly as a way of tracking improvement.
